The baptism in Romans 6 is not a simple external ritual. This baptism points to the faith by which a person unites in their heart with the Lord’s baptism, death, and resurrection. Looking at its true meaning from the perspective of the gospel of the water and the Spirit, it represents the truth showing that Jesus had the sins of the world transferred to Him through the baptism He received from John, was crucified, and resurrected from death to become our Savior.
